Chris Licht
American television newsman and producer (born 1971) / From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Christopher Andrew Licht (born October 22, 1971)[2] is an American television newsman and producer. He is best known as the showrunner and executive producer of The Late Show With Stephen Colbert, as well as CBS's executive vice president of special programming. He is also known for having launched Morning Joe on MSNBC, and the reboot of CBS This Morning. From May 2022 to June 2023 he was the chairman and CEO of CNN.
